QUALCOMM INC 2.15 percent 20May2030 is a Senior Unsecured Note issued by the corporate entity on the 6th of May 2020. QUALCOMM is trading at 85.34 as of the 1st of May 2024, a 0.57 percent increase since the beginning of the trading day. The bond's open price was 84.86. QUALCOMM has about a 40 percent probability of financial distress in the next few years of operation and has generated negative returns over the last 90 days. Business ConcentrationSemiconductors & Semiconductor Equipment, Information Technology, QUALCOMM INCORPORATED Corporate Bond, Miscellaneous, Media/Communications (View all Sectors)
Sub Product AssetCORP
Next Call Date20th of February 2030
Coupon Payment FrequencySemi-Annual
CallableYes
Sub Product Asset TypeCorporate Bond
NameQUALCOMM INC 2.15 percent 20May2030
C U S I P747525BK8
Offering Date6th of May 2020
Coupon2.15
Debt TypeSenior Unsecured Note
I S I NUS747525BK80
Yield To Maturity5.41
Price82.04
QUALCOMM INCORPORATED (747525BK8) is traded in USA.
